Syndicate scrapped

Chautara, October 24:

The syndicate system of goods carriers, which had been enjoying monopoly in transportation of Chinese goods imported through the Tatopani check point on Araniko Highway, has been scrapped.

A meeting between Sindhupalchok Chamber of Commerce and Industries, Nepal Trans-Himalayan Trade Association, members of the Constituent Assembly and truck and container entrepreneurs decided to put an end to the system. Traders said transport fares would be cheaper after the end of the system.

However, president of Trans-Himalayan Trade Association Durga Bahadur Shrestha said fare rates have not been changed yet even though the syndicate system has been dissolved.
